    1. At the Pakistani consulate Michael Weston introduces himself as a reporter named "Rich Franklin", who is actually a UFC fighter and former Middleweight champion to whom the lead actor, Jeffrey Donovan, bears a very close resemblance.
    2. Michael introduces himself to the con-artist as "Davis Cullen". T. Cullen Davis was a Texas oil heir who was arrested but acquitted in 1977 for the murder-for-hire of his estranged wife's daughter and boyfriend (the wife was wounded and survived). He was arrested again in 1978 for soliciting the murder of the same estranged wife and the judge overseeing their ongoing divorce, but he was again acquitted after forensic discourse analysis concluded that his words in the recorded conversation with the undercover operative posing as a hitman did not constitute solicitation.

        Double Booked

        S02E08 Episode aired 11 September 2008
        1. After Larry leaves Sam and Michael, having suggested substantial amounts of murder, Sam says "That's our Larry." This is likely a reference to Mel Brooks "The Producers" (2005), where, while holding auditions for the play being produced, the lead is chosen with the line "That's our Hitler!"
        2. In the ambulance Sam tells Finona "Well he's no Campbell" Sam is played by Bruce Campbell.
        3. When Larry Sizemore (Tim Matheson) finds out that Drew booked additional hitmen to kill his stepmother Jeannie (hence the episode's title), he gets angry and says "Drew--dead! Jeannie--dead! The houseguest--dead!" This monologue is a reference to the following exchange between Bluto (played by John Belushi) and Otter (played by Matheson) in Animal House (1978): Bluto: "Wormer, he's a dead man! Marmalard, DEAD! Niedermeyer--" Otter: "Dead!"
        4. Tim Matheson directed several episodes of Burn Notice, including this one, and also plays Larry who's first appearance is in this episode

          Hot Spot

          S02E11 Episode aired 29 January 2009
          1. The "phone-book bulletproofing" was tested by Mythbusters (Coll. 7; Ep. 8). They proved that the set-up used would protect from small arms fire used in the ambush scene. (Note: but not against heavy weapons like shotgun slugs or high-powered rifles)
          2. Sam Axe (Bruce Campbell) at one point says "You know, for the kids." This is a direct reference to The Hudsucker Proxy (1994) in which Campbell plays a supporting role. The line is a slightly different version of the movie's famous, oft-uttered line: "You know, for kids." Sam says "You know, for THE kids" because he's referring to 2 kids specifically (Corey and Tanya, the kids he's helping out) unlike in 'Hudsucker' where the line refers to kids in general.
